About Daimler Cars

Daimler ranks 119th out of 145 car manufacturers for MOT reliability, with an average pass rate of 77%. That's 5 points below the national average of 82%, so Daimler owners should budget a bit more for maintenance.

With 9 models across 17 years of data (1990 to 2006), there's a wide spread of 29 percentage points between the most and least reliable models. Choosing the right model matters significantly with Daimler.

Most and Least Reliable Daimler Models

The Eagle Auto leads the range with a 94% average pass rate from 32 tests. At the other end, the Limousine Auto has the lowest at 65%.
